# Environments: PinPoint Autocomplete

Three environments: dev, staging, prod. Dev resets nightly. Staging mirrors prod data minus the Harwick dataset. Promotions go dev → staging → prod; no direct prod pushes. Staging smoke tests must pass before release sign-off. Prod config is locked behind change review. Current staging values are as follows.

settings of kafop-fahog:
PRAWYN_PIN=8793
PRAWYN_METRICS_HOST=metrics.prawyn.lumiccorp.corp
PRAWYN_LOG_LEVEL=warn
PRAWYN_TENANT=kasox

Nightly reindex for Quillfeather Search kicks off at 02:10 local. Confirm the crawler queue is drained before cutover; if not, abort and page the Lanternhill search rotation. Swap the alias only after doc counts match within 0.5%. Rollback is alias flip plus cache purge, nothing else. The reindex job manifest must be signed before dispatch. Sign with the key below.

deploy key for kajof-fajop: bky6_gDHw9Q

// MAX_VALIDATOR_PLUGINS caps how many third-party validators the Sievewright
// runtime will load per tenant. Support note: when customers report silent
// validation skips, check whether they exceeded this cap — plugins past the
// limit are dropped without error (known gap, fix tracked). Raising the cap
// requires a runtime restart and re-registration of every plugin manifest.
// The value below was last tuned against the build whose identifier appears
// immediately after this comment.

trace token, fafog-kageg: htk4_98e6

**Alert: ReportForge sort instability.** Exports from the Quartzbay report builder intermittently reorder rows with equal sort keys between runs, causing diff noise for downstream consumers. Root cause is the switch to the parallel sort in release 4.2, which is not stable. Mitigation is to append a tiebreaker column. Ongoing occurrences and the proposed fix are tracked on the internal page.

runbook for taduf-kawef: https://confluence.qorvelsys.internal/projects/display/display/pages